Practical Tips to Extend the Service Life of LED Displays

LED displays have become indispensable in various fields, from commercial advertising billboards and stage backdrops to public information screens and indoor monitoring systems. With their high brightness, energy efficiency, and wide viewing angles, they offer long-term value—but their lifespan can be significantly shortened without proper care. Industry data shows that a well-maintained LED display can operate stably for 80,000 to 100,000 hours (equivalent to 8–10 years under normal use), while neglectful maintenance may reduce this by 30% to 50%. To help users maximize the longevity and performance of their LED displays, here are proven, actionable strategies.

Conclusion

Extending the service life of an LED display is not a one-time task but a long-term commitment to environment control, parameter optimization, regular maintenance, and quality management. By following these strategies, users can not only reduce replacement costs but also ensure the display maintains consistent performance—whether it’s a commercial billboard driving brand awareness, a stage display enhancing entertainment experiences, or a public information screen keeping communities informed. As LED technology continues to advance, proper care will remain the most cost-effective way to unlock the full potential of these versatile devices.
